Our Athlon motherboard review is now online for some 36 hours and already a whole lot of things have happened. Effect number one was that Asus received tons of mail from people enquiring about their Athlon-board. The result is very satisfying, after some six hours of negative responses Asus started replying to everyone that they will start shipping their Athlon-board by the end of September.

Have a look at those emails:

I received this forwarded Asus-mail from Lance Rissman yesterday (August 18, 1999) around 1 PM EDT:

Dear Sir/Madam,

Thank you for supporting our products.


There is still indefinite date for the release of such motherboard..
However, the K7 M/B has already been under prototyping and beta testing..
The price will vary due to the competition when releases.

This mail was received by Jeb Boniakowski a little later:

Dear Sir

Thank you for using Asus Products!


The board will soon be released.
But the release day is not yet determined.

Best Regards


ASUSTeK Technical Support Division.

Finally, Asus sent this mail to Adam Nachtgeist:

It'll be released by the end of the month.


Thanks
Sales dept

I guess that this is quite an achievement, generated by a flood of emails of people who would like to see an Athlon-motherboard from Asus.
